The Physician & APC Emerging Leader empowers Physician’s & APC’s who are new to their role or to leadership, to build the essential skills needed for high performance in healthcare settings. The program reinforces the practical skills and personal development which successful leadership at any level is built upon. Participants will learn about individual and group behaviors that lead to high performance.

Learning Objectives
After completing this program, participants will be able to:
• Identify key concepts of healthcare financial management.
• Explain principles of operational management and workflow optimization
• Apply strategic planning techniques to align daily operations with broader organizational goals
• Describe the clinician leader’s role in driving financial stewardship and operational excellence
• Distinguish between change management and change leadership, and articulate the role of a leader during change
• Recognize the emotional impact of change on individuals and teams
• Apply change ‘Prosci’ Change model to real-world leadership scenarios
• Practice communication techniques that promote transparency, engagement, and trust during change
• Develop strategies to address resistance and sustain momentum in long-term change efforts
• Describe key components of effective, data-informed decision-making
• Apply frameworks for prioritization when making complex decisions
• Understand strategic planning tools (e.g., SWOT analysis, SMART goals) to align team goals with organizational priorities
